This is my code:
import sys
if (sys.version_info > (3, 0)):
import urllib.request as urllib
else:
import urllib2 as urllib
import os
import py7zlib
def download(url, output):
data = urllib.urlopen(url)
with open(output, "wb") as f:
f.write(data.read())
def check_dir(dir):
if (os.path.isdir(dir)):
pass
else:
os.makedirs(dir)
def dec_7z(file_name, output):
with open(file_name, 'rb') as f:
archive = py7zlib.Archive7z(f)
for name in archive.getnames():
print(name)
outfilename = os.path.join(output, name)
outdir = os.path.dirname(outfilename)
check_dir(outdir)
with open(outfilename, 'wb') as outfile:
outfile.write(archive.getmember(name).read())
url = "https://sourceforge.net/projects/sevenzip/files/LZMA%20SDK/lzma1900.7z/download"
file_name = "lzma1900.7z"
download(url, file_name)
dec_7z(file_name, "7z")
Run it, but get this:
...
Java/SevenZip/Compression/RangeCoder/Decoder.java
Java/SevenZip/Compression/RangeCoder/Encoder.java
Java/SevenZip/CRC.java
Java/SevenZip/ICodeProgress.java
Java/SevenZip/LzmaAlone.java
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"down7z.py", line 37, in <module>
dec_7z(file_name, "7z")
File "down7z.py", line 31, in dec_7z
outfile.write(archive.getmember(name).read())
File "C:\ProgramData\Anaconda3\envs\py27\lib\site-packages\py7zlib.py", line 6
32, in read
data = getattr(self, decoder)(coder, data, level, num_coders)
File "C:\ProgramData\Anaconda3\envs\py27\lib\site-packages\py7zlib.py", line 7
02, in _read_lzma
return self._read_from_decompressor(coder, dec, input, level, num_coders, wi
th_cache=True)
File "C:\ProgramData\Anaconda3\envs\py27\lib\site-packages\py7zlib.py", line 6
70, in _read_from_decompressor
tmp = decompressor.decompress(data)
ValueError: data error during decompression
